Abstract

Provided is a technology for detecting abnormal temperature rise of a battery regardless of the number of batteries, and preventing a trouble caused by abnormal temperature rise. A battery production facility () for producing a secondary battery () comprises an abnormality detector () for detecting abnormal state (especially, abnormal temperature rise) of a plurality of secondary batteries (, . . . ), and a detector () for generating a control signal in order to take a predetermined step according to the detection result from the abnormality detector (). The abnormality detector () comprises a low temperature reactant () provided in contact with a part of the secondary battery () which becomes high temperature easily and reacts at a temperature lower than the temperature at which the secondary battery () becomes abnormal state, and a detection sensor () for detecting change of the low temperature reactant (), and detects abnormal state of the secondary battery () according to the detection result from the detection sensor ().
